Marie-Françoise-Anne LEVITRE was born 19 September 1733 in Québec, Canada, New France

Marie-Françoise-Anne LEVITRE was the child of Francois LEVITRE   and   Marie-Geneviève MARTIN dite JOLICOEUR and the grandchild of: (paternal)  Guillaume LEVITRE and Geneviève LANGLOIS (maternal)  Nicolas MARTIN dit JOLICOEUR and Marie-Madeleine LAREAU

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Marie-Françoise-Anne  married  Louis-Richard CORBIN 1 March 1756 in Québec, Canada, New France .  The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Louis-Richard CORBIN  was born 4 July 1732 in Québec, Québec, Canada (Quebec City).  Louis-Richard died 10 October 1780 in Chambly, Québec, Canada (Saint-Joseph-de-Chambly).  Louis-Richard was the child of Gaspard-Richard CORBIN and Madeleine ROLLAND dite BONNEAU.

Marie-Françoise-Anne LEVITRE died 2 March 1819 in Québec, Lower Canada .

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
